  • Special Committee to Report on Academic Freedom in Florida January 26, 2023
    The AAUP has appointed a special committee to look into recent attacks on higher education in the state of Florida.
  • Florida College System Censorship Can Not Stand January 20, 2023
    The AAUP condemns the decision made by the presidents of the Florida College System to re-evaluate course offerings in order to root out any content that promotes "critical race theory or related concepts such as intersectionality." The AAUP is prepared to take necessary action against the FCS, including investigation and censure.
  • AAUP Launches Inquiry into Hamline University January 19, 2023
    The AAUP has launched an inquiry into the decision of Hamline University administrators not to rehire part-time instructor Erika López Prater after a Muslim student complained about López Prater's showing an Islamic painting of the Prophet Muhammad in an art history class.   • AAUP Files Brief Supporting Student Debt Relief January 12, 2023
    The AAUP joined the AFT and AFSCME in filing an amicus brief supporting the Biden administration's efforts toward student debt relief. 
  • Income-driven Repayment Proposal Promising January 10, 2023
    The US Department of Education's proposal includes promising reforms that would help numerous borrowers. The proposal would lift the qualifying discretionary income cap, reduce monthly payments, and decrease time to forgiveness for those with undergraduate loans, providing much-needed relief.   • Hamline Should Reinstate Instructor January 6, 2023
    The AAUP is troubled to learn that an art history instructor at Hamline University suffered repercussions from the university’s administration after showing a slide, in a class on Islamic art, of a fourteenth-century Islamic painting of the Prophet Muhammad.
